Transaction 9558c2afa4c240f61d93fa0416594838e6e0421c6c58c5747d321dda643885ca

1 Input
2 Outputs
  • 9558c2afa4c240f61d93fa0416594838e6e0421c6c58c5747d321dda643885ca:0
  • value  1972331
    address  3FhB6aLRo3etqx2Bo3nc6QCQtrBdFZe769
  • 9558c2afa4c240f61d93fa0416594838e6e0421c6c58c5747d321dda643885ca:1
  • value  237943058
    address  3Jru4Qi3ZoPac1dqsTqYMud5gzXJYqa8wg